ggplot2画图的强大之处想必用过R的都有所了解,关于ggplot2这个包就有专门的书籍介绍。
ggplot2基本要素:
数据(Data)和映射(Mapping)
几何对象(Geometric)
标尺(Scale)
统计变换(Statistics)
坐标系统(Coordinante)
图层(Layer)
分面(Facet)
主题(Theme)
关于ggplot2的讲解会持续更新。本次介绍一些绘图基础知识。
所有ggplot2绘图,都是调用函数ggplot(),提供aes()指定的默认数据和映射。 然后,您可以使用+添加图层,标尺,坐标和分面。 要将曲线保存到磁盘,请使用函数ggsave()。
1. ggplot —— 创建一个新的ggplot
2. AES —— 构建映射
3. +.gg —— 将组件添加到图
4. ggsave —— 使用合理的默认值保存ggplot(或其他网格对象)
5. qplot quickplot —— 快图
###1. ggplot —— 创建一个新的ggplot
#ggplot()格式:
ggplot(data = NULL, mapping = aes(), ..., environment = parent.frame())
# 生成一些数据,并计算每组的均值跟方差
df <- data.frame(
gp = factor(rep(letters[1:3], each = 10)),
y = rnorm(30)
)
ds <- plyr::ddply(df, "gp", plyr::summaris
ggplot2绘图基础

最低0.47元/天 解锁文章
2938

被折叠的 条评论
为什么被折叠?



